Abstract
The invention discloses a kind of new-type wave energy power generator, comprising: wave state transferring structure, for receiving the motive force of wave transmitting, so that the motive force pushes gas to flow and be converted to electric energy;Power generator is connected with the wave state transferring structure, and is located at wave state transferring structure top, for receiving electric energy;Support construction is fixed for supporting to the power generator.Using the embodiment of the present invention, structure is simpler, is easily worked, and manufacturing cost is lower, and noise is small;It can be arranged in around ocean platform and provide a certain amount of electric power for ocean platform, and the fixed device in seabed can be shared with ocean platform, while the device can reduce the loss of part wind energy, improve the utilization efficiency of wave energy, further increase generating efficiency.

Background technique
Increasingly depleted with fossil energy, the development and utilization of new energy receives more and more attention, new energy
It has been trend of the times.New energy includes solar energy, biomass energy, water energy, wind energy, geothermal energy, wave energy, ocean current energy and tide
Can etc., so far, with most broad range of techniques it is most mature be solar energy and wind energy.Ocean occupies the earth about 70%
Area, contained by wave energy be inexhaustible.Wave energy be in a kind of specific form and ocean energy of ocean energy most
One of main energy, its development and utilization are very important alleviating energy crisis and reducing environmental pollution.Surging
Ocean wave motion generates huge, eternal and environmentally friendly energy, if can fill the wave energy of the kinetic energy of wave and other waters surface
Divide and use, then the prospect of world energy sources can be quite wide and bright.
It can utmostly be exactly wave-energy power generation by way of wave energy.Current wave-energy power generation existing in the world
Device has hydraulic type, direct-drive type, fluid pressure type etc..They largely all exist volume is excessive, cost is excessively high, processing is more complex,
The disadvantages of noise is larger, perishable.

As Fig. 1-2 present invention provides a kind of new-type wave energy power generator, comprising: wave state transferring structure, for connecing
The motive force of wave transmitting is received, so that the motive force pushes gas to flow and be converted to electric energy;Power generator, with the wave
State transferring structure is connected, and is located at wave state transferring structure top, for receiving electric energy;Support construction, for pair
The power generator support is fixed.
It is understood that power generator is connected with wave state transferring structure, and it is located on wave state transferring structure
Portion, when wave state transferring structure is with wave vertical tremor, wave state transferring structure receives the motive force of wave transmitting, with
Make the motive force that gas be pushed to flow and be converted to electrical energy for storage in power generator, support construction and power generator phase
Even, it is fixed for being supported to power generator.
Preferably, the power generator, comprising: cylinder 5, annular mesh enclosure 6, cylinder cover 7, backstop plate 9, rectangular box 10, electricity
Machine 1001, battery 1002, fan 11, annular bent plate 12;
Annular 12 ring of bent plate sets the cylinder 5;
The annular mesh enclosure 6 is connected with the annular bent plate 12, and is set to the outside of the annular bent plate 12;
One end of the cylinder cover 7 is connected with the annular mesh enclosure 6, and the other end is connected with the backstop plate 9, and cylinder cover
7 are provided with hollow region, and the rectangular box 10, the motor 1001 and the battery are provided in the hollow region
1002 are connected, and are set to inside the rectangular box 10;
The fan 11 is set to the lower part of the rectangular box 10.
It should be noted that the wind flowed in air is flowed by annular mesh enclosure 6 and along the curved surface of annular bent plate 12
Device, the device can reduce the loss of part wind energy, improve wave power utilization efficiency.Purpose is arranged with backstop plate 9 in annular mesh enclosure 6
It is to prevent rubbish and birds from entering device, influences the normal operation of fan 11, be provided with rectangular box 10 in 7 hollow region of cylinder cover,
Rectangular box 10 is fixed at the center of backstop plate 9, fan 11 is fixed by bolts in the lower part of rectangular box 10;Positioned at rectangular box
Motor 1001 in 10 is connected with battery 1002 by electric wire 15, when fan 11 rotates, can be driven inside rectangular box 10
Generator 1001 generate electricity, be transmitted in battery 1002 and stored by electric wire 15, such as Fig. 1, Fig. 5.
In a kind of implementation, the wave state transferring structure, comprising: floating structure 1, upper piston rod 2, multiple springs
3, piston 4;
Described 2 one end of upper piston rod is connected with the floating structure 1, and the other end is connected with piston 4;
The multiple spring 3 is set to the bottom of the cylinder 5;
The piston 4 is movably set in the cylinder 5.
It is understood that floating structure 1 is vibrated up and down with wave, when floating structure 1 slowly enters wave crest section, upper piston
Bar 2 moves upwards in cylinder 5 with piston 4, the upward motion of air in pusher cylinder 5, and the wind flowed in air then passes through
Annular mesh enclosure 6 and the device is flowed into along the curved surface of annular bent plate 12, converged with the air pushed in cylinder 5, to push
Then the rotation of fan 11 drives the generator 1001 inside rectangular box 10 to generate electricity, is transmitted to battery 1002 by electric wire 15
In stored;When floating structure 1 slowly enters trough section, upper piston rod 2 moves downward in cylinder 5 with piston 4, when
When piston 4 touches multiple springs 3, multiple springs 3 work as a buffer piston 4, and when piston 4 moves upwards from push
Effect, to realize integrally-built power generation process.
It is worth noting that: the motor and accumulator equipment of whole device are commonly used equipment, belong to existing mature technology,
This repeats no more its electrical connection and specific circuit structure.
Preferably, the support construction, comprising: V-type steel construction 8, supporting structure 13, floating support 14;
Described 8 one end of V-type steel construction and the backstop plate 9 weld, and the other end is weldingly connected with the supporting structure 13;
The supporting structure 13 is connected with the floating support 14.
It should be noted that supporting structure 13 is connected with floating support 14, floating support 14 is fastened on seabed with anchor chain, by floating support
14, which are set as two, is used to guarantee integrally-built stability.
In a kind of implementation, the multiple spring 3 at least two.
Preferably, 1 surface of floating structure is equipped with screw thread slot 101.
It is understood that the end of thread of upper piston rod 2 is fixed on the screw thread slot 101 that 1 surface of floating structure is equipped with, it will
Threaded bolt holes 201 on upper piston rod 2 are matched with the screw thread slot 101 that 1 surface of floating structure is equipped with, and are carried out by bolt
It is fixed, guarantee structural stability, such as Fig. 3, Fig. 4.
